The meaning(s) of SAMAR:
The name Samar is an Arabic baby name. In Arabic the meaning of the name Samar is: Conversations at night.
The name Samar is a Muslim baby name. In Muslim the meaning of the name Samar is: Evening conversation.
USA SSA birth(s) for SAMAR:
Here is the latest 16 years from USA social security list of total babies born with the name SAMAR
SAMAR as a boy
| Year | Boy Births |
|---|---|
| 2024 | 62 births |
| 2023 | 56 births |
| 2022 | 92 births |
| 2021 | 85 births |
| 2020 | 67 births |
| 2019 | 73 births |
| 2018 | 76 births |
| 2017 | 71 births |
| 2016 | 67 births |
| 2015 | 62 births |
| 2014 | 60 births |
| 2013 | 46 births |
| 2012 | 36 births |
| 2011 | 32 births |
| 2010 | 31 births |
| 2009 | 17 births |
SAMAR as a girl
| Year | Girl Births |
|---|---|
| 2024 | 27 births |
| 2023 | 27 births |
| 2022 | 24 births |
| 2021 | 32 births |
| 2020 | 22 births |
| 2019 | 30 births |
| 2018 | 28 births |
| 2017 | 28 births |
| 2016 | 31 births |
| 2015 | 28 births |
| 2014 | 28 births |
| 2013 | 21 births |
| 2012 | 22 births |
| 2011 | 15 births |
| 2010 | 33 births |
| 2009 | 17 births |
About the name SAMAR
The name **Samar** carries a rich tapestry of meaning and cultural significance, originating from Arabic, where it translates to "companion in evening talk" or "entertaining conversation." This evocative name embodies warmth and connection, evoking images of intimate gatherings under starlit skies. In South Asian cultures, particularly within India and Pakistan, Samar is often linked to the idea of fruitfulness and bounty, symbolizing hope and prosperity. Its roots extend beyond the Middle East and South Asia, finding resonance in various cultures, including Persian and Urdu, where it embodies qualities of companionship and joy in storytelling. Popular across diverse regions, Samar is embraced in many countries, including Iraq, Lebanon, and Bangladesh, making it a name that transcends borders.
